Ingredients

For the Strawberries

  • 2 pounds fresh strawberries
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ar

For the Whipped Cream

  • 2 cups heavy whipping cream, very cold
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ract

For the Cake Base

  • 1 (10-12 ounce) store-bought angel food cake or pound cake

How to Make Quick Strawberry Shortcake Cups

Step 1: Prepare the Strawberries

In a medium bowl, combine sliced strawberries and sugar. Let sit for 10 minutes to allow the strawberries to release their juices.

Step 2: Prepare the Cake

If using store-bought shortcakes, crumble them into bite-sized pieces. If using pound cake, cut or crumble it into small pieces.

Step 3: Layer the Ingredients

In serving cups or glasses, layer the crumbled shortcake or pound cake. Spoon a layer of macerated strawberries and their juices over the cake layer.

Step 4: Add Whipped Cream

Top with a generous dollop of whipped cream. Repeat layers until cups are filled, ending with a swirl of whipped cream.

Step 5: Garnish and Serve

Garnish with a fresh strawberry slice and mint leaf if desired. Serve immediately or refrigerate for up to 1 hour before serving.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When making Quick Strawberry Shortcake Cups, a few common pitfalls can affect your dessert’s outcome. Here are some mistakes to watch out for:

  • Skipping the maceration step: Not allowing strawberries to sit with sugar means you may miss out on delicious juices. Always let them rest for about 10 minutes.
  • Using warm cream: Whipping cream at room temperature won’t hold its shape. Ensure your heavy whipping cream is very cold before whipping to achieve fluffy peaks.
  • Overcomplicating layers: Trying to make intricate layers can lead to messy cups. Stick with straightforward layering for an appealing presentation.
  • Ignoring portion sizes: Filling cups too full can make them difficult to serve and eat. Keep an eye on portion sizes for the best experience.
  • Storing incorrectly: Not refrigerating leftover cups right away can lead to sogginess. Cover any leftovers and refrigerate immediately.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ds fresh strawberries
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 cups heavy whipping cream
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• 10–12 ounces angel food cake or pound cake

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Strawberries: Slice strawberries and mix with sugar in a medium bowl. Allow them to sit for 10 minutes to release their juices.
  2. Prepare the Cake: Crumble store-bought angel food cake or pound cake into bite-sized pieces.
  3. Layer the Ingredients: In serving cups, layer crumbled cake, spoon over macerated strawberries and their juices.
  4. Add Whipped Cream: Top with whipped cream and repeat layers until cups are filled, finishing with whipped cream on top.
  5. Garnish and Serve: Optionally garnish with fresh strawberry slices or mint leaves before serving.
